
A 99-YEAR-OLD Army veteran returned to Arnhem yesterday, where he climbed from his wheelchair to salute his fallen friends from 80 years ago.
Geoff Roberts was the only one of our war heroes fit enough to come back to remember those killed at the Battle of Arnhem in September 1944.
He asked to be taken to a specific section of the cemetery where his comrades were buried.
There he rose from his wheelchair, walked to their graves and gave an emotional salute.
Asked what it was like to be back, Mr Roberts told the Mirror: "I've got mixed feelings.
"I was captured in the Arnhem area in 1944 and was taken prisoner and was held POW for the rest of the war, but I will never forget the kindness of the people.
